Quest Car Care Products is growing and looking to add a Fulfillment Specialist to our team. The Fulfillment Specialist is responsible for supporting daily manufacturing operations through hands-on production, packaging, and fulfillment work. In this role, we need you to be reliable, flexible, and willing to assist wherever needed on the production floor. We would love someone that is looking for long-term employment to grow with us. You will be joining a highly functioning team with a great culture that helps each other succeed both personally and professionally. Quest Car Care Products manufactures high-quality chemicals trusted by car washes, truck washes, and detailers. Our comprehensive range includes pre-soaks, degreasers, specialty cleaners, shampoos, ceramic-infused products, waxes, tire shine, dressings, fragrances, aerosols, and reclaim water care. With our strong marketing support and a dedicated team, we are committed to ensuring our customers' success. As a Fulfillment Specialist at Quest Car Care Systems, some of your duties will include: Fill pails, drums, and containers using manual and automated equipment Operate filling, packaging, and basic production machinery Label containers accurately and ensure proper product identification Inspect finished products for defects, leaks, or labeling errors Assist with packaging, sealing, and palletizing finished goods Move raw materials, packaging, and finished goods throughout the facility Operate forklifts, pallet jacks, drum carts, and other material-handling equipment Stage finished products for shipment Assist with order fulfillment and loading as needed Maintain clean, organized, and safe work areas Assist with general facility cleaning and maintenance tasks Support equipment cleaning between production runs Properly dispose of waste and recycling materials Work cooperatively with Team Leaders and coworkers Communicate issues related to quality, safety, or equipment We would expect our ideal candidate to have the following experience and skills: High school diploma or GED required Previous experience in manufacturing, fulfillment, or production environments preferred Ability to read, understand, and follow written and verbal instructions Basic math skills for accurate measuring, weighing, and recording of materials Strong attention to detail with a focus on quality, accuracy, and consistency Ability to follow standard operating procedures (SOPs), safety rules, and chemical handling requirements Willingness to wear required PPE and comply with all safety policies Ability to work independently and collaboratively in a fast-paced production environment If you are interested in working with a great, established, and growing company, please apply confidentially today at https://questccp.bamboohr.com/careers/19.
